The Effect of Chemically Active Media on the Structure and Properties of Cubic Boron Nitride

Summary: | Properties of cubic boron nitride (cBN) powders from 2 to 200 mm particle size have been studied before and after chemical treatment. Impurity compositions of the bulk and surface, density, magnetic, electrophysical, physicochemical, and radiospectroscopic characteristics are considered. Structural changes in samples and the origin of the observed effects are discussed. |
